How it works
The calculator uses the standard industry formula for typing speed measurement. Words per minute is calculated by dividing total characters by 5 (the standard characters-per-word ratio) and then dividing by the time in minutes. This accounts for the fact that an average word contains 5 characters. Net words per minute adjusts the WPM score by deducting errors proportionally to the test duration, providing a more realistic assessment of actual typing ability. Accuracy percentage is determined by dividing correct characters by total characters and multiplying by 100. Worked example
Imagine you complete a one-minute typing test and type 250 total characters with 5 mistakes. The calculator first determines your gross WPM: 250 characters divided by 5 equals 50 words, which divided by 1 minute equals 50 WPM. Your characters per minute is straightforward at 250 CPM. To find net WPM, errors are deducted: 5 errors divided by 1 minute equals 5 WPM deduction, giving you 45 net WPM. Your accuracy is calculated as (250-5)/250 = 0.98 or 98%. Understanding WPM and Typing Metrics
Words per minute (WPM) is the standard metric for measuring typing speed. The industry standard defines one word as five characters, including spaces. This allows fair comparison across different texts and typing styles. Most professional typing tests use this same five-character word definition. Average typing speed varies by skill level: casual typists average 40 WPM, intermediate typists achieve 60-80 WPM, and professional typists often exceed 100 WPM. Accuracy is equally important as speed, with professional standards typically requiring 95% or higher accuracy. The combination of speed and accuracy provides the most complete picture of typing proficiency.
Gross vs. Net Words Per Minute
Gross WPM represents your raw typing speed without error deductions. Net WPM provides a more accurate assessment by subtracting errors from your gross score. This penalizes mistakes proportionally to test duration, reflecting real-world typing where errors must be corrected. For example, making 10 errors in a one-minute test deducts 10 WPM from your score, while the same 10 errors in a two-minute test deducts only 5 WPM. Professional typing certifications and employers typically focus on net WPM as it reflects actual usable typing speed. Comparing your gross and net WPM helps identify whether you need to focus on accuracy improvement or speed development.
Improving Your Typing Speed
Consistent practice is the most effective way to increase typing speed. Regular typing practice, even for 15-20 minutes daily, produces measurable improvements within weeks. Focus on proper finger positioning and home row placement to develop muscle memory and eliminate looking at the keyboard. Start by prioritizing accuracy over speed; speed naturally increases as accuracy improves. Use typing practice software with realistic texts and progressive difficulty levels. Take regular typing tests to track progress and identify specific problem areas. Consider typing games and exercises that make practice more engaging. Remember that individual improvement rates vary based on starting skill level and practice frequency.
Accuracy: The Often-Overlooked Metric
While speed attracts attention, accuracy determines actual productivity and professionalism. A typist achieving 60 WPM with 95% accuracy produces usable work, while one achieving 80 WPM with 80% accuracy spends significant time correcting mistakes. Professional standards typically require 95-98% accuracy minimum. Accuracy depends on multiple factors: keyboard familiarity, text difficulty, concentration level, and typing technique. Poor posture, incorrect finger placement, and rushing contribute to accuracy loss. Developing accuracy requires conscious attention to proper form and resisting the urge to type faster before mastering current speed. The most successful typists balance speed and accuracy development equally.
Common Typing Speed Benchmarks
Typing speed expectations vary by profession and role. Data entry specialists should achieve 60-80 WPM with high accuracy. Administrative assistants typically maintain 50-70 WPM. Programmers often develop 70-100 WPM as they frequently type code. Transcriptionists require 65-100 WPM depending on specialization. Customer service representatives average 40-60 WPM. Students should target at least 40 WPM for academic efficiency. These benchmarks help you set appropriate goals based on your profession. Factors Affecting Typing Performance
Numerous variables influence typing speed and accuracy on any given test. Physical factors include keyboard quality, chair comfort, lighting conditions, and ambient noise level. Environmental distractions reduce focus and increase errors significantly. Text difficulty matters considerably; technical content requires slower, more careful typing than familiar prose. Hand warmth and stretching before testing improve performance. Mental factors including stress level, fatigue, and concentration directly impact results. Time of day affects performance, with most people typing fastest during morning and early afternoon hours. Consistent testing conditions allow accurate tracking of improvement over time. Consider these factors when evaluating typing test results.
